Shade & highlight partners

Suggested shadow and highlight colors for Steel Grey, picked from the full catalog by color science — not paints you own. Shadows stay richer when they lean cool; pure black just flattens them. Highlights read best warmer and a touch softer than the base; pure white bleaches them out.

Matches are computed by converting each paint's color to CIELAB and measuring CIE76 deltaE distance. A “great match” (deltaE < 3) is very close to the eye; a “close match” is a usable substitute. Finish, opacity, and coverage still differ between brands, so test on primer when it matters.
